MCC seals six shops

Mysore/Mysuru: The Mysuru City Corporation (MCC) officials, who raided shops in MCC Zone-6 limits recently, have sealed six shops which did not have valid licence to conduct business and had not paid Property Tax.

The MCC officials led by Zone-6 Commissioner Manjunath, raided shops on K.T. Street in Ward No. 41 and found six shops operating without valid licence and had not paid the tax. The officials sealed the six shops and asked the shop owners to immediately obtain trade licence and pay the taxes.

Manjunath said that notices were served to these shop owners earlier and as there was no response from them, the shops were sealed.

MCC Zone-6 Revenue Officer J. Asha, Assistant Revenue Officer M.S. Siddaraju, Health Inspector G.V. Yogesh, Kantharaj and others took part in the drive.
